Health Tip: Making Changes To Your Family's Diet?

(HealthDay News) -- If you're thinking about changing your family's diet and fitness regimen, the American Dietetic Association says you should set realistic goals.

Here are some suggestions:

  • Decide on two or three specific, small changes in eating or physical activity at a time. Don't overdo it all at once.
  • Write down your family's weekly goals and keep track of them.
  • Keep a daily food and activity log.
  • Don't expect perfection.
  • Reward your family for positive change.
